The unconscious man wheeled into Dr. Rebecca Dahlman's ER is sexy-devilishly sexy-and injured. This isn't just any patient in need of medical help. He is the only man she's ever loved-the one who still haunts her dreams.

Black Phoenix bassist Dominic Price made a mistake three years ago when he walked out on Rebecca. A mistake he plans to rectify. But first he has to convince her to open her heart to him again. One touch of his calloused hands reignites their passion.

Can they rekindle their trust as easily, or will her fears cause her to lose him again...this time to a man bent on revenge?

Sarah Grimm is an award-winning, best-selling contemporary romance author addicted to fast cars, reading and laughter. She lives in West Michigan with her husband, two sons, and three dogs and has a penchant for dropping F-bombs like the rock stars she loves to write about.

She is a proud member of Romance Writers of America and Novelists, Inc.

Not having read the previous book in the Black Phoenix series I thought I'd feel a loss when reading this installment but it can definitely stand quite well on its own. While characters from the previous book show up here to further work out their own issues, they're also there to support sexy Brit Dominic as he tries to reclaim the one woman to capture his heart. It's a rocky road to redemption for him though in an intensely emotional roller coaster ride for readers that's ultimately immensely satisfying.

Dominic's childhood was one of tears and loss as his drug addicted mother died when he was a baby leaving him alone with her body before he found a home. Growing up he was a sickly youngster, never able to fit in. He always felt alone. Even as his band gained fame and the adulation rolled in he knew it wasn't real. He was used to hearing the words, I Love You, in connection with what a person wanted from him so he never put any value in it. The night a fiery redhead uttered those words though everything changed for him and his fear of what it truly meant had him running and her heartbroken. He's reached a turning point and is tired of being alone and watching everyone else find happiness which leads him back to Rebecca, but she won't make it easy for him. It will take raw honesty and heartfelt words, along with lots of hot sex, to win her over. Dom is super sexy, charming, and exudes sensuality which left me drooling over him. His pain is very apparent though and had me rooting for him to finally make a family of his own as he's been flitting from one group to another trying to find a place to belong.

Rebecca is at a crossroads too. She's a strong-willed woman who's very smart and capable but her family, particularly her father, have never been truly proud of her. They've always found some part of her life lacking and continually try to force her to live out their choices. These feelings of inadequacy have her feeling lost, alone, and unhappy. The only time she was truly happy was in Dominic's arms. Though she's never forgotten him, and still longs for him, she's still reeling from his leaving. When he comes into her ER battered and broken she finally gets the chance to make him pay for his leaving without a word. The intense feelings between them though make that a difficult plan and instead have her fighting for a new life and her last chance at happiness in an ending that's heartwarming, heartbreaking, and sexy....along with a slightly unexpected twist.

This was a quick read with likable and realistic characters. Each character is unique and larger than life with emotions that jump off the page. The relationship between Dom and Rebecca puts readers through the emotional wringer and brings realistic and relatable feelings to the forefront as their journey to HEA goes through many ups and downs. The music world is just touched on here but gives a realistic view of the downtime between touring and record making. I found myself easily immersed in this story and desperate for more as the band's new drummer sounds deliciously enticing and is single. With its storyline teeming with sexual tension, strong main and secondary characters, and abundance of emotions this was an immensely satisfying story that I highly recommend to those who love drool-worthy yet flawed heroes and the strong-willed women who love them!
